| Khael11-19-05, 03:14 PM | I just found some stuff on Dragon Gods/ took a look-see at your website link. Somehow from the few dragon gods i found on here and the few Kaiju gods i looked at, i get the impressive its not gonna happen, if only because: 1) the two kinds at too elemental, they're more likely to rip into one another or have an uneasy truce than side together (unless your thinking of a campaign where something threatens those gods enough to make them consider destroying the plane/continent/country to take out the threat, and the PCs must therefore stop the threat to save their own hides). 2) The D&D gods tend to avoid interference with mortals(probably because if God Y interferes with God Z's minions God Z will side with God X to elimate a good selection of god Y's followers in vengence etc.) Therefore since the Kaiju gods are more of mortal vein, the D&D gods(dragon gods included) will more likely look down on them, unless the Kaiju threaten them, in which case its war (Similar to as stated in 1) then). In short by all means it possible to put both in my game, but its likely to be either a war on mortal plane or between planes (the Kaiju gods invade the D&D world from another plane maybe or vice versa). Just my reckonings here on the limited information i've gleaned in the time, but still i say could be very interesting a campaign . |
